
Musée de la Vie Rurale
Saint-Quentin-Fallavier · Isère ·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es
The Museum of Rural Life, established in 1990 at the Gargues Estate in Saint-Quentin-Fallavier in Isère, is dedicated to the agricultural and craft heritage of the region. Its collections, restored and preserved by a volunteer association, document rural life from the 19th century through agricultural materials, tools and machinery. The exhibitions occupy a 1500 m² building and several rooms of a Dauphiné farmhouse, allowing an immersive presentation of past practices. The museum offers regular guided tours and organizes demonstrations of traditional techniques such as the making of wooden clogs, walnut oil or flour. It annually organizes a "Festival of the Thresher and Old Machines" and provides equipment rental services for exhibitions.
